ICDI, CMU Welcomes Study Visit Delegation from PSU to Exchange Best Practices in International Program Management and Development

3 April 2026
International College of Digital Innovation
On 1 April 2026, Assistant Professor Dr. Chaiwuth Tangsomchai, Associate Dean of the International College of Digital Innovation, Chiang Mai University (ICDI, CMU), warmly welcomed a study visit delegation from the Bachelor of Business Administration Program in Management and Entrepreneurship (International Program), Faculty of Management Sciences, Prince of Songkla University (PSU), led by Assistant Prof.Dr. Natika Chaiyanupong, Director of Management and Entrepreneurship (International Program), Faculty of Management Sciences, Prince of Songkla University . The visit was organized as part of a knowledge-sharing session on program management and educational quality development at ICDI, CMU.

On this occasion, Assistant Professor Dr. Chaiwuth Tangsomchai delivered a presentation on key topics, including resource management, technological infrastructure, learning environment, and staff development. Assistant Professor Dr. Aniwat Phaphuangwittayakul, Chair of the Undergraduate Program, also shared insights on program performance monitoring and international program marketing strategies. The delegation was further welcomed by Ms. Pantinee Nestsupaluk, College Secretary, along with ICDI staff members.

This knowledge exchange reflects the strong academic collaboration between higher education institutions in advancing and enhancing the quality of international programs. It emphasized the application of the AUN-QA framework and benchmarking processes as systematic and continuous approaches to development, while also fostering knowledge exchange among academic networks to collectively elevate international education standards.
